General and Task Management
Work to ensure people and resources are applied in an efficient and effective manner to meet delivery requirements while achieving quality and safety standards
Ensure that team members follow defined manufacturing procedures and comply with quality requirements
Ensure full adherence to 5S (Sort, Set In Order, Shine, Standardize, Sustain) practices at all times
Ensure equipment is within calibration date and all systems are functioning correctly
Ensure all records are completed appropriately
Ensure that non-conforming material is clearly identified and segregated
Ensure that the escalation procedure for quality concerns is followed
Ensure achievement of production throughput against stated capacity targets.
Ensure the team are aware of day-to-day targets and responsibilities
Manage work order closures and stock control transactions
Maintain visible lead for adherence to procedures and instructions
Monitor change over and/or line set up efficiency
Prepare line set-ups for following shifts, including first piece buyoffs
Monitor and maintain all safety equipment and tools
Undertake continuous training and development
Perform root cause analysis and resolve problems
Identify business improvement opportunities within the organization
Identify and deploy the technical skill sets, resource levels and systems to deliver projects, including the engagement of external resources as required
Conduct risk assessments of processes and tasks in the department
People Management
Responsible for training of operators for products and processes within the local team
Responsible for daily management and support for the team to achieve operational success
Monitor time and attendance and ensure compliance with Company procedures
Carry out incident, accident and non-conformity investigations and associated reporting and action closure
Monitor the completion of tasks and ensure good performance and record on appropriate systems
Consistently promote high standards through personal example and roll out through the team so that each member of the team understands the standards and behaviors expected of them
Communicate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) from the strategic annual plan so that each employee is aware of expectations and deliverables
Provide product expertise within team, and respond to operator queries
Work positively with support functions to fully define the processes/procedures/controls relevant to team activities. Provide support and input to continuous improvement activities within the team
Relationship Management
Interface with Production Scheduling to determine schedules for shift production
Liaise and communicate with other departments and ensure an effective interface is maintained
Feedback to the Management team to share ideas and improve operation, recommending, supporting and implementing continuous improvement activities and process and procedure improvements to optimize results and improve quality of delivery, in line with quality standards requirements and delivery in line with Company and Customer requirements
Provide technical expertise to the team
